S E C 8412. ELIMINATION OF WAIVERS OF 50:50 RULE FOR HMO ENROLLMENT. (a) IN GENERAL.—

(1) Section 1876(f) of the Social Security Act (42 U.S.C. 1395nun(f)), as amended by section 4018(a) of the Omnibus Budget Rm)nciliation Act of 1987, is amended by striking paragraph (3) and by redesignating paragraph (4) as paragraph (3). (2) Subsection (c) of section 4018 of the Omnibus Budget Reconciliation Act of 1987 is repealed. (b) EFFECTIVE DATE.—The amendments made by subsection (a) shall not apply to contracts in effect on the date of the enactment of this Act or extensions (not exceeding 90 days) thereof.

S E C 8413. INCREASE IN AUTHORIZATION FOR THE PATIENT OUTCOME ASSESSMENT RESEARCH PROGRAM.

Section 1875(c)(3) of the Social Security Act (42 U.S.C. 139511(c)(3)) is amended to read as follows: "(3)(A) For purposes of carrying out the research program, there are authorized to be appropriated— "(i) from the Federal Hospital Insurance Trust Fund twothirds of the amount specified in subparagraph (B), and "(ii) from the Federal Supplementary Medical Insurance Trust Fund one-third of the amount specified in subparagraph (B). "(B) The amount specified in this subparagraph is— "(i) $7,500,000 for fiscal year 1988, "(ii) $10,000,000 for fiscal year 1989, "(iii) $20,000,000 for fiscal year 1990, and "(iv) $30,000,000 for fiscal year 1991.".
